Company Overview
Pylon Electronics Inc. is an ISO/IEC 17025 accredited calibration facility supporting both electronic and physical test equipment and is one of the largest Canadian Owned Calibration Laboratories. Pylon Electronics has a solid reputation in the repair and calibration of measuring instruments. We currently have seven laboratories located in Montreal (QC), Ottawa (ON), Toronto (ON), Dartmouth (NS), Calgary (AB), Edmonton (AB), and Richmond (BC).
